When seeking rehab near Ashley, it's important to understand the types of care available. Treatment isn't one-size-fits-all. Options range from medically supervised detoxification, which manages withdrawal safely, to inpatient residential programs that provide intensive, round-the-clock care in a structured setting. For many, outpatient programs are a vital option, allowing individuals to receive therapy and support while maintaining work or family commitments in Ashley. The choice depends on the severity of the addiction, personal circumstances, and health needs. A great starting point is to consult with your primary care physician in Ashley or call a confidential helpline for an assessment.
While Ashley itself may not host a large residential facility, excellent treatment centers are accessible within a manageable drive. Nearby cities like Centralia, Mount Vernon, and even the greater St. Louis metropolitan area offer various accredited programs. When researching, look for facilities that are licensed by the Illinois Department of Human Services, Division of Substance Use Prevention and Recovery. It's also crucial to find a center that treats co-occurring mental health conditions, as these often accompany addiction. Don't hesitate to ask about their therapeutic approaches, such as cognitive-behavioral therapy, group sessions, and family counseling.
